1961 front page: ‘U.S. breaks off relations with Cuba’

The move to nor­mal­ize re­la­tions between the U.S. and Cuba comes more than 54 years after Pres­id­ent Dwight D. Eis­en­hower broke off dip­lo­mat­ic re­la­tions with Fi­del Castro’s re­gime. Here’s a look at the front page of the Los Angeles Times on Janu­ary 4, 1961, the day after Eis­en­hower is­sued the fol­low­ing state­ment:

“There is a lim­it to what the United States in self-re­spect can en­dure. That lim­it has now been reached.”
